15:01:47 <e0ne> #startmeeting horizon 15:01:49 <openstack> Meeting started Wed Jun 24 15:01:47 2020 UTC and is due to finish in 60 minutes. The chair is e0ne. Information about MeetBot at http://wiki.debian.org/MeetBot. 15:01:50 <openstack>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 15:01:52 <openstack> The meeting name has been set to 'horizon' 15:02:06 <vishalmanchanda> hi 15:02:09 <rdopiera> o/ 15:02:19 <e0ne> hi 15:04:18 <e0ne> ok. let's start 15:04:37 <e0ne> #topic Notices 15:05:11 <e0ne> we reached victoria-1 milestone last week 15:05:21 <e0ne> nothing special for horizon 15:05:46 <e0ne> we'd got 18.4.1 release ready 15:06:19 <e0ne> it's mostly to understand if plugins can work with the latest horizon 15:06:33 <e0ne> vishalmanchanda: thanks for taking care of releases! 15:06:44 <vishalmanchanda> e0ne: sorry for an extra release:(. 15:06:48 <vishalmanchanda> e0ne: yw. 15:07:06 <e0ne> vishalmanchanda: it's ok, don't worry 15:08:39 <e0ne> the next milestone is Victoria-2 in about one month 15:09:01 <e0ne> as agreed during the PTG we'll have a virtual mid-cycle around that date 15:09:11 <e0ne> #link https://releases.openstack.org/victoria/schedule.html#v-2 15:09:22 <vishalmanchanda> e0ne: cool. 15:10:26 <e0ne> that's all updates from me for this week 15:10:58 <e0ne> #topic Horizon and NPM 15:11:47 <vishalmanchanda> I have few update on nodejs- job failures. 15:12:06 <e0ne> vishalmanchanda: oops, I'm sorry, I forgot it 15:12:28 <vishalmanchanda> e0ne: carry on. 15:13:15 <e0ne> #topic nodejs-* jopbs 15:14:26 <e0ne> vishalmanchanda: it's your turn:) 15:14:37 <vishalmanchanda> e0ne: thanks Ivan. 15:14:49 <vishalmanchanda> I have backported nodejs job fix patches till stable/stein. Please review them. 15:15:00 <vishalmanchanda> https://review.opendev.org/#/q/7cd0debebe1a300a96f8d0f21626793be0a0bc41 15:15:47 <vishalmanchanda> Also for stabl/rocky 'horizon-dsvm-tempest-plugin' job is failing due to uwsgi issue is not fixed in devstack in stable/rocky branch. Once devstack is fixed for rocky then we can purpose nodejs patch to stable/rocky. 15:16:00 <vishalmanchanda> #link http://lists.openstack.org/pipermail/openstack-discuss/2020-June/015558.html 15:16:41 <vishalmanchanda> This is the failure in my testing patch https://zuul.opendev.org/t/openstack/build/2f8ab7a81dac4e499bcc4ceec5258458/log/job-output.txt#6061 15:18:12 <vishalmanchanda> Also for plugins I have pushed patch for fixing nodejs job in openstack/senlin-dashboard and openstack/searchlight-ui 15:18:36 <e0ne> vishalmanchanda: thanks a lot for fixing our gates! 15:19:07 <vishalmanchanda> If you see the same issue in any other plugin feel free to fix it. 15:19:44 <vishalmanchanda> I hope this patch https://review.opendev.org/#/c/737359/ will also works for other plugins as well. 15:20:44 <vishalmanchanda> Do we really need to fix gate for stable/rocky? 15:21:15 <rdopiera> RH doesn't support rocky anymore 15:21:55 <vishalmanchanda> then we can skip it for rocky. 15:22:05 <e0ne> I think it's good to have a fix to stable/rocky too if it's just a cherry-pick 15:23:25 <vishalmanchanda> Ok let's wait for devstack to fix uwsgi issue in rocky then we can proceed. 15:23:52 <e0ne> +1 15:24:18 <vishalmanchanda> that's all update from my side on nodejs fix. 15:26:55 <e0ne> ok, let's move on 15:26:58 <e0ne> #topic nodejs-* jopbs 15:27:10 <e0ne> #topic Horizon and NPM 15:27:28 <e0ne> it's something we need to think about sooner or later 15:27:55 <e0ne> I hope everybody have seen a '[horizon] patternfly?' discussion in the mailing list 15:28:00 <e0ne> #link http://lists.openstack.org/pipermail/openstack-discuss/2020-June/015551.html 15:28:30 <e0ne> I don't expect any agreement right now, but we can't ignore it forever 15:31:24 <e0ne> I would like to discuss it during the virtual mid-cycle 15:33:02 <vishalmanchanda> +1. 15:34:36 <rdopiera> I wonder if we could explicitly invite the people who expressed interest in JavsScript in Horizon before 15:34:50 <e0ne> rdopiera: +1 15:35:10 <rdopiera> because they seem to be discouraged by the current situation, but maybe if we could get them together, they could start a horizon-next project 15:36:04 <e0ne> that's a good point. I'l send a message to a mailing list with it 15:37:46 <e0ne> but it will be after a poll, which I have to setup, to select a date for a mid-cycle 15:39:29 <e0ne> we can move to next topic if we've got anything more to discuss today 15:41:19 <vishalmanchanda> nothing from my side. 15:41:21 <e0ne> I don't have anything more to discuss now 15:41:58 <rdopiera> nothing 15:42:15 <e0ne> let's wrap up the meeting 15:42:34 <e0ne> thanks everybody for your contributions! see you next week 15:43:06 <e0ne> #endmeeting